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
最近の wercker 便利って話 #tqrk10
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Daisuke Fujita
May 29, 2016
Programming
960
2
Share
最近の wercker 便利って話 #tqrk10
TokyuRuby会議 10
http://regional.rubykaigi.org/tokyu10/
での飛び込み LT 資料です
Daisuke Fujita
May 29, 2016
More Decks by Daisuke Fujita
See All by Daisuke Fujita
SREcon19 Asia/Pacific Recap
dtan4
0
220
Our Practices of Delegating Ownership in Microservices World
dtan4
4
9k
Kubernetes Cluster Upgrade / Mercari Meetup for Microservices Platform
dtan4
3
4.8k
KubeCon EU 2018 Recap: Multi-Tenancy in Kubernetes: Best Practices Today, and Future Directions / Kubernetes Meetup Tokyo 11 #k8sjp
dtan4
1
2k
Wantedly から Chef を一掃した話 / #chibadan
dtan4
24
11k
さようなら Chef こんにちは Dockerfile / Web Tech Tokyo #1
dtan4
6
7.3k
Docker をフル活用したインフラの紹介と成長し続けるためのインフラ戦略 / #abejameetup
dtan4
19
4.1k
Docker Compose PaaS の作り方、そして社内に導入した話 / #yapc8oji
dtan4
1
8.7k
Writing Kubenetes tools in Go
dtan4
1
3.8k
Other Decks in Programming
See All in Programming
AI駆動開発で崩れていくコードベースを立て直す
kyoko_nr_nr
1
400
The Arts and Crafts of Work in the AI Era — Toward Mastery in Software Development
kuranuki
1
690
AIエージェントの隔離技術の徹底比較
kawayu
0
450
Claspは野良GASの夢をみるか
takter00
0
150
自動レビューエンジンの実装と運用 ~レビューのない世界へ~
kurukuru1999
2
310
Technical Debt: Understanding it Rightly, Engaging it Rightly #LaravelLiveJP
shogogg
0
180
正しくソフトウェアを作る、前提を疑うための認知の視点 / doubt-premise
minodriven
6
2.7k
権限チェックの一貫性を型で守る TypeScript による多層防御
mnch
4
1k
AIエージェントと協働するCLI開発 — BunとOpenClawで学んだこと
yoshikouki
1
230
Stage 3 Decorators でできること / できないこと / TSKaigi 2026
susisu
1
1.4k
[KCD Czech] eBPF Meets the GPU: Future of AI Infra Observability
doniacld
0
130
タクシーアプリ『GO』の バックエンド開発のおける AI利活用と若者のすべて
pyama86
3
1.8k
Featured
See All Featured
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Sharpening the Axe: The Primacy of Toolmaking
bcantrill
46
2.8k
Jess Joyce - The Pitfalls of Following Frameworks
techseoconnect
PRO
1
160
Designing for Timeless Needs
cassininazir
1
240
A Modern Web Designer's Workflow
chriscoyier
698
190k
Efficient Content Optimization with Google Search Console & Apps Script
katarinadahlin
PRO
1
580
Paper Plane
katiecoart
PRO
1
50k
Lessons Learnt from Crawling 1000+ Websites
charlesmeaden
PRO
1
1.3k
Marketing Yourself as an Engineer | Alaka | Gurzu
gurzu
0
210
The Hidden Cost of Media on the Web [PixelPalooza 2025]
tammyeverts
2
320
What the history of the web can teach us about the future of AI
inesmontani
PRO
1
600
Rails Girls Zürich Keynote
gr2m
96
14k
Transcript
࠷ۙͷXFSDLFS ศར͍ͬͯ͏ 2016-05-29 #tqrk10 @dtan4
!EUBO
EUBOUFSSBGPSNJOH
EUBOQBVT Docker Compose-compatible OSS PaaS
XFSDLFS
IUUQXFSDLFSDPN
XFSDLFS • ϓϥΠϕʔτϦϙδτϦແݶʹ CI Ͱ͖Δͭ • Docker-base CI • ࠷ۙࢿۚௐୡͨ͠
Amsterdam & SF based Startup
None
8FSDLFS8PSLqPXT • Jenkins, Concourse CI Ͱ͓ೃછΈͷ ϫʔΫϑϩʔػೳ͕ಋೖ͞Εͨ • ෳύΠϓϥΠϯΛฒྻͰ࣮ߦͰ͖Δ •
͏͚ͩͳΒແྉʂʂʂʂʂʂʂʂ
https://app.wercker.com/#applications/57397bbed99505465708deb7
https://app.wercker.com/#applications/57397bbed99505465708deb7
None
ศར • ϏϧυύΠϓϥΠϯΛׂɾฒྻ࣮ߦͰ͖ΔͷͰ ૯࣮ߦ͕࣌ؒॖ͢Δʢ͔ʣ • ׂͨ͠ύΠϓϥΠϯ୯ҐͰ࠶࣮ߦͰ͖Δ • feature spec ͕ͳΜ͔ࣦഊͨ࣌͠ͱ͔ʂ
• Heroku, ECS, Kubernetes, Docker Registry σϓϩΠΛαϙʔτ
ݫ͍͠ • λεΫؒͰΩϟογϡ $WERCKER_CACHE_DIR ͕ڞ༗͞Εͳ͍ • ͱΓ͋͑ͣຖճ bundle install …
• ෳλεΫͷ݁ՌΛड͚࣮ͯߦɺΈ͍ͨͳ ͜ͱ͕Ͱ͖ͳ͍ • શλεΫऴྃޙʹ·ͱΊͯ slack-notify Έ͍ͨͳ • ແྉͩͱฒྻ 2
None
None
·ͱΊ • Wercker Workflow ศརʂ • ࣾͰঃʑʹରԠ͍ͤͯͬͯ͞Δ • …ͱ͍͑ɺ͍͠ͱ͜Ζ͋ΔͷͰ Slack
ͱ͔Ͱ ϑΟʔυόοΫʂ • wercker ͬͱ͞ΕΔ͖